Singer and actress Jisoo, formerly of BLACKPINK, has established her own agency, BLISSOO, in February 2026, marking a significant shift towards managing her career independently. This new phase allows her professional freedom, a theme echoed in her role as a webtoon producer in the Netflix series 'Boyfriend on Demand,' which premiered on March 6, 2026.
Jisoo's journey began in 2011 as a trainee with YG Entertainment. After five years, she debuted with BLACKPINK, a group that became a global phenomenon. Now, as a solo artist under BLISSOO, she aims to explore new opportunities, including a planned full solo album and audiovisual content release in 2026.
Her acting career is also expanding with 'Boyfriend on Demand,' where she plays a character navigating work pressures and a virtual dating app. Jisoo identifies with her character's need for personal time and embrace of change. She also signed a global deal with Warner Records for her solo music career.
Looking ahead, Jisoo expresses a strong desire to visit Brazil, a country with a large fanbase that has supported BLACKPINK. She hopes to connect with her passionate Brazilian fans soon, potentially during a future solo tour.
